2026 FIFA World Cup Format Overview
The 2026 FIFA World Cup in the U.S., Canada, and Mexico will feature 48 teams divided into 12 groups, with each team playing three group stage matches. The knockout stage will include 32 teams, comprising group winners, runners-up, and the best third-placed teams.
Expanded Knockout Stage
Unlike previous years, the 2026 tournament will see 32 teams progressing to the knockout stage, leading to more thrilling matches and competition.
Tiebreakers for Group Stage
In case of tie situations, various criteria such as points, goal difference, goals scored, and fair play will determine the team's position in the group standings.
Qualifying Process
The qualifying teams will be ranked based on points, goal difference, goals scored, fair play, and FIFA world ranking to identify the best third-placed teams.
